[QUOTE="ionbeam, post: 1255321, member: 277"] I'm using the ADV wireless (waterproof) key fob with ADV LEDs. I have it clipped to 'stuff' on the left handlebar for easy access. I find that I have a summer setting for the low beam brightness and a winter setting because it's dark going to work and coming home so I don't need the same brightness as summer where it's light both ways. Once set I rarely make adjustments. When I turn on the hi beams it triggers the LEDs to 100% output = stadium lighting. The power controller is stashed under the cowling and there is no need to route wires through the plastic.
